Output e9f6209020366412544b9559436ae09f9014b1027341ba427931621fe1807b58:0

value
13211136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640deaa9b27e8bf20b8b2673aed6827a1b530fb3 OP_EQUAL
address
3Ap4AfyHM11AzKTQEtXHfe3eb7QNsbwQ9R
transaction
e9f6209020366412544b9559436ae09f9014b1027341ba427931621fe1807b58
confirmations
107003
spent
true